Shock to the system.

Not as big a fan of gaming as some friends of mine, I still love the escapism and design of a good video game. So it reeaaally takes something pretty special to catch my attention. Enter 'BioShock'. With a highly detailed, 1950's art deco design, and a movie like immersive quality, this is one rare and beautiful piece of design, with influences of 'Lost' & 'The Shining' to name a few.


Hyped for months, and deservedly so, it's already been recommended to me several times, and the demo only appeared this week alone. Great design, with a pretty gripping story too.
